Rendimiento de WooCommerce

¿Sitio WooCommerce Lento? Cómo solucionarlo

¿Estás buscando diagnosticar y arreglar un WooCommerce lento? Con nuestros consejos, tendrás una tienda de eCommerce que carga rápidamente y ayuda a evitar los muchos problemas que pueden surgir cuando un sitio web funciona lentamente.

La velocidad de su sitio web es tan importante como su aspecto y funcionalidad. Puede mejorar su posicionamiento en los motores de búsqueda, lo que ayuda a atraer más clientes potenciales a su sitio. Además, puede mejorar enormemente la experiencia del usuario; como sabrá por su propio uso de la web, no hay nada más molesto que un sitio web que carga lentamente. Al final, tener un sitio rápido es un componente esencial para conseguir el mayor número posible de conversiones, que debería ser su objetivo final como propietario de un negocio.

En este artículo, vamos a echar un vistazo más de cerca a lo que puede causar que un sitio WooCommerce se ralentice y ofrecer algunos consejos útiles sobre cómo puede solucionar el problema. 

¿Cómo de rápido debería ser tu sitio WooCommerce? 

La respuesta es sencilla: lo más rápido posible. La velocidad del sitio web tiene un impacto tan significativo en el éxito de un WooCommerce que a todos los empresarios debería interesarles reducir sus tiempos de carga todo lo que puedan. 

Un tiempo de carga de página rápido mejorará su SEO, lo que hará que su sitio web WooCommerce suba más en la página de clasificación de resultados de búsqueda y le permitirá llegar a nuevos clientes. La velocidad rápida del sitio también mejora la experiencia del usuario de tu tienda WooCommerce, ayudando a aumentar su reputación y fiabilidad, lo que debería conducir a más conversiones. 

Como mínimo, querrá que su sitio se cargue a una "velocidad media", que ronda los cinco segundos. Pero para obtener mejores resultados, debería cargar su sitio en menos de un segundo. Según un estudio las cargas de un segundo mejoran 5 veces la tasa de conversión que las que se cargan en diez segundos. Es otra forma de decir: cada segundo cuenta realmente para tu éxito. 

Con un sitio rápido, se reduce la probabilidad de que el visitante se distraiga con el correo electrónico, el teléfono o cualquier otra cosa. Es una forma de asegurarte de que tienes su atención. Un sitio WooCommerce lento perderá clientes que ponen su atención en otra cosa. Y un sitio muy lento perderá clientes potenciales porque tendrán dudas sobre la fiabilidad del sitio. 

woocommerce lento

¿Qué hace que un sitio WooCommerce sea lento? 

En esta sección, repasaremos algunas de las principales razones por las que tu tienda WooCommerce puede estar funcionando lentamente. No te preocupes si crees que puedes tener uno o dos de estos problemas - te explicaremos lo que puedes hacer para solucionarlos en la siguiente sección. Pero por ahora, centrémonos en las causas más comunes. 

Proveedores de alojamiento lentos

Siempre es una buena idea verificar la calidad y las credenciales de tu proveedor de hosting. Existen muchas empresas que ofrecen hosting web barato, o incluso gratuito, pero como con la mayoría de las cosas, obtienes lo que pagas (o no pagas). Esos proveedores generalmente no tienen la capacidad de ancho de banda para soportar un gran número de visitantes en el sitio web o un plugin de WordPress como WooCommerce funcionando a una gran escala. En este caso, no habrá nada incorrecto de tu parte; simplemente tu plan de hosting no está a la altura del trabajo.

Usar alojamiento compartido para tu tienda de comercio electrónico puede estar bien para tiendas muy pequeñas. Sin embargo, es probable que te encuentres con problemas una vez que empieces a escalar, ya que los temas de WooCommerce requieren más potencia de la que los proveedores baratos son capaces de proporcionar. 

Sin CDN

CDN son las siglas de Content Delivery Network (Red de Entrega de Contenidos). Se trata de una red de servidores ubicados en diferentes lugares que tienen copias en caché del contenido estático de su sitio. Por ejemplo, sus imágenes, archivos Javascript, hojas de estilo y otros datos sincronizados durante las copias de seguridad. Cuando un visitante llega a su sitio web, la CDN le mostrará datos extraídos del contenido almacenado en caché del servidor más cercano a su ubicación, lo que se traducirá en tiempos de carga más rápidos. 

Si no dispone de una CDN, el contenido de su sitio se servirá desde el servidor de su proveedor de alojamiento web en lugar de desde los centros de datos, independientemente de dónde se encuentre el visitante. Esto puede dar lugar a tiempos de carga de página lentos, especialmente para los visitantes que acceden a su sitio web desde lejos. A su vez, este tiempo lento de carga de la página puede resultar en credenciales SEO inferiores y hacer que su visitante abandone su página, perjudicando su tasa de conversión.

Sin caché 

El almacenamiento en caché de los datos a los que se accede con más frecuencia es un componente fundamental de los sitios web con tiempos de carga rápidos. Estos datos se almacenan en la memoria del servidor o en el disco duro, lo que permite acceder rápidamente a ellos en el futuro. Una forma inteligente de reducir el tiempo que se tarda en servir estos datos es utilizar un complemento de almacenamiento en caché que almacene en caché el contenido estático de su sitio, pero sigue siendo mejor disponer de un almacenamiento en caché primario. Almacenamiento en caché de WooCommerce en lugar de depender de un plugin de WordPress. 

Los mejores proveedores de hosting gestionado, como Saucal, Kinsta y WP Engine, ofrecen caché como parte de su servicio para ayudar a optimizar el tiempo de carga.

Imágenes no optimizadas

Necesitarás buenas imágenes en el front-end de tu sitio para aumentar la participación de los usuarios. No puedes sacar el máximo partido a un tema de WordPress atractivo sin imágenes de calidad. Pero es importante pensar en cómo esas imágenes pueden afectar al backend de tu sitio web. Las imágenes que tienen un tamaño de archivo más grande de lo necesario pueden tardar más en cargarse y mostrarse que las imágenes que han sido optimizadas. 

Base de datos lenta

Todo el contenido, la configuración y los datos de usuario de su sitio se almacenarán en la base de datos de su sitio web. Cuando un visitante interactúa con su sitio web, se consulta la base de datos para ayudar a generar la página web solicitada por el usuario. Por ello, la velocidad de la base de datos es clave para la velocidad del sitio web. Si funciona con lentitud, la página solicitada tardará mucho en mostrarse al usuario. Y eso conduce a una mala experiencia de usuario.

Hay toda una serie de razones por las que su Base de datos WooCommerce puede ser lenta. Podría deberse a una cantidad excesiva de consultas a la base de datos, a consultas a la base de datos mal optimizadas o a un diseño ineficiente de la base de datos. 

Temas de WordPress malos o incompatibles

Es importante elegir el tema adecuado para tu sitio de WordPress. Mucha gente sólo se fija en los elementos de diseño del tema, pero un buen tema es mucho más que su atractivo estético inicial. Un tema de baja calidad puede contener demasiados scripts de hojas de estilo CSS, lo que ralentizará la velocidad de nuestro sitio web. Lo mejor es utilizar un tema que haya sido optimizado para el rendimiento mediante AJAX, para que tus visitantes puedan navegar desde la página de destino hasta su carrito de la compra y, finalmente, pasar por caja sin problemas. 

Problemas con los plugins

Necesitarás - y querrás - tener plugins para tu tienda de comercio electrónico en WordPress. Pero es importante recordar que si tienes demasiados, pueden entrar en conflicto entre sí. Esto puede provocar que las páginas se bloqueen y otros errores evitables que ralentizarán la experiencia del usuario en su sitio.

También deberías comprobar que el plugin es totalmente compatible no sólo con WordPress sino también con WooCommerce. Si no lo es, entonces podría haber algunas características y funcionalidades de WooCommerce con las que el plugin tenga problemas, lo que también podría ralentizar tu sitio. 

No está utilizando la última versión de PHP

Tanto WordPress como WooCommerce utilizan PHP para generar contenido dinámico en su sitio web. Las últimas versiones de PHP se construyen teniendo en cuenta el rendimiento, lo que les permite proporcionar tiempos de carga más rápidos para su sitio web. Sin embargo, sólo obtendrás esos beneficios si utilizas la última versión de PHP. Las últimas versiones ofrecen un rendimiento mejorado y correcciones de errores que mantendrán su sitio funcionando lo más rápido posible. 

También hay otras razones para actualizar a la última versión de PHP. Es posible que WooCommerce y WordPress no admitan versiones anteriores, lo que podría suponer un riesgo para la seguridad o presentar problemas de compatibilidad. 

Solución de problemas comunes con la velocidad de página de WooCommerce 

Lidiar con un sitio WooCommerce lento es frustrante, pero no es tan difícil. Si no te gusta lo que ves en la página de resultados de tu Pingdom o Gtmetrix de análisis de velocidad/prueba de velocidad, entonces es hora de comenzar el proceso de solución de problemas para resolver cualquier inconveniente de rendimiento. Existen muchas maneras de mejorar la velocidad de carga de tu tienda en línea y asegurarte de que tu sitio cargue rápidamente, incluyendo analizar tus plugins de WooCommerce, optimizar tus archivos de imagen y revisar a fondo a tu proveedor de hosting de WooCommerce.

Optimice sus plugins

Tus plugins no te ayudarán si están perjudicando activamente el rendimiento de tu sitio web. Para optimizar tus plugins, prueba lo siguiente:

Mantenga sus plugins actualizados: Los plugins obsoletos son más propensos a tener problemas relacionados con el rendimiento y a contener errores. Asegúrate de actualizar tus plugins siempre que se publique una nueva versión.

Limitar el número de plugins: Una página web tardará más en cargarse si utilizas docenas de plugins. Además, pueden interactuar negativamente entre sí. Limita tus plugins a solo los que realmente necesites.

Utilice plugins ligeros y bien codificados: Un plugin ligero y bien codificado tendrá menos probabilidades de afectar al rendimiento de su sitio web. Evita los plugins que consuman muchos recursos o estén mal codificados.

Desactive los plugins que no utilice: Los plugins inactivos todavía pueden afectar a su sitio, así que asegúrese de desactivar activamente cualquiera que no esté en uso.

Utiliza un perfilador de rendimiento de plugins: Estos pueden funcionar como una herramienta de prueba que mostrará cuáles de sus plugins están utilizando más recursos. A partir de ahí, puedes optimizar los plugins o eliminarlos por completo.  

Optimizar imágenes

Las imágenes de productos de alta calidad en una página web de comercio electrónico son importantes, pero es esencial pensar en cómo afectarán a sus métricas de velocidad. La optimización de imágenes puede ayudarle a reducir el tamaño del archivo de la imagen sin reducir la calidad antes de volver a cargar la imagen en su servidor web.

Existen herramientas, como TinyPNG, que pueden ofrecer este servicio. Otra opción más efectiva es usar un plugin como ShortPixel Image Optimizer, que te permitirá optimizar todas tus imágenes desde dentro de WordPress sin afectar el tamaño de la página.

Optimizar las tablas de la base de datos

Si te estás preguntando, "¿por qué mi tienda WooCommerce es lenta?" entonces la respuesta podría estar en las tablas de tu base de datos. Si están llenas de datos, tardarán más en reaccionar. Puedes mejorar el rendimiento de tu base de datos con un mantenimiento regular, incluyendo el uso del complemento Query Monitor, que ofrece soluciones de depuración eficaces. También se recomienda utilizar una herramienta de limpieza de WooCommerce como Clean Up Booster. Esto eliminará automáticamente los datos innecesarios de tus tablas de datos. Es especialmente recomendable para usuarios que carecen de conocimientos técnicos, ya que te permite optimizar tu sitio muy fácilmente.

Cambiar de alojamiento

No importa lo que hagas: si tienes un servicio de hosting deficiente, tu sitio tendrá más probabilidades de funcionar lentamente. Un buen servicio de hosting, como Saucal, tendrá la infraestructura que necesitas para tener un sitio de funcionamiento rápido y podrá manejar plugins como Jetpack, tus imágenes y mucho más.

Mejore su sitio hoy mismo asociándose con un proveedor de alojamiento web rápido como Saucal, que ofrece soluciones de alojamiento gestionado a precios asequibles. Las soluciones vienen con toda una serie de características útiles, incluyendo copias de seguridad diarias, almacenamiento en caché y almacenamiento SSD. 

Utilizar la caché 

El almacenamiento en caché es muy recomendable, especialmente desde su alojamiento gestionado, pero si eso no es una opción, las opciones de plugins de almacenamiento en caché están ahí, pero no son la opción escalable (y en algunos casos, son causas de lentitud o uso intensivo de recursos).

Estas opciones incluyen WP Rocket, que puede acelerar potencialmente tu sitio web al almacenar copias estáticas de tus archivos importantes, como imágenes y páginas HTML, en las computadoras de los visitantes, lo que significa que no necesitarán descargarlos nuevamente cada vez que visiten tu sitio. Hay muchos plugins disponibles como W3 Total Cache, WP Super Cache, Autoptimize, y Fastest Cache. Sin embargo, destacamos que la mejor opción estará del lado del servidor.

woocommerce lento

Un consejo experto para que el tiempo de carga sea productivo

Si has consultado nuestras entradas anteriores sobre rendimiento y aún no hay mucho que puedas hacer para mejorar el rendimiento, todavía hay algunos trucos que puedes hacer para mejorar el rendimiento.

Incluso después de aplicar tantos ajustes de rendimiento como sea posible a algunos sitios, hay algunas cosas que no se pueden superar. Para esos casos, siempre es posible hacer que el sitio parezca receptivo durante el pago aunque no lo sea.

Un cambio que mejoró los ingresos de nuestros clientes es hacer una pantalla de "carga" entretenida. En lugar del icono de carga predeterminada, le añadimos mensajes personalizados y bonitas animaciones.

Gastar 5 o 7 segundos en un spinner no es exactamente lo mismo que una rotación de 3 mensajes de 2 segundos cada uno diciendo cosas como "gracias por elegirnos", "prepárate para asombrarte", "las cosas buenas sólo pasan después de este punto" o algo que vaya bien con tu branding.

El cliente medio no técnico no pensará que el sitio está atascado si la pantalla está haciendo algo y mostrando texto, con lo que se reduce la posibilidad de rebote.

Matias Saggiorato, Director Técnico de Saucal

Obtenga WooCommerce gestionado por Saucal para una velocidad y funcionalidad optimizadas 

¿Cansado de tener un WooCommerce lento? Lo entendemos. Los problemas de velocidad de WooCommerce pueden ser molestos en el mejor de los casos y perjudiciales en el peor. Después de todo, la gente espera que los sitios web que visitan funcionen rápido, y si tu sitio no lo hace, entonces es probable que estés perdiendo un gran número de conversiones que podrían tener un impacto significativo en los ingresos de tu negocio.

La buena noticia es que hay un montón de cosas que puedes hacer que te ayudarán a mejorar tu WooCommerce lento - y mantenerlo así. Si estás buscando alguna ayuda adicional para mejorar la velocidad de tu sitio, entonces ponte en contacto con nosotros aquí en Saucal. Los sitios web de carga lenta son cosa del pasado. Dale a tu sitio la velocidad que se merece, y estarás en camino de tener una ventaja competitiva sobre tus competidores.

Ofrecemos un servicio WooCommerce gestionado que se asegurará de que usted tiene todos los componentes clave que conducen a un sitio web rápido como un rayo.